Welcome to Haven Sampoorna, a delightful culinary sanctuary nestled on Pandian Street in Velachery, Chennai. This vegetarian haven transcends the ordinary dining experience, beckoning food enthusiasts with its diverse range of cuisines including Continental, Mexican, Thai, and North Indian delicacies.
As you step through the entrance, the cramped facade gives way to a warm and inviting ambiance that instantly transports you to a world where the joy of dining thrives. The interior may be modest in size, yet it is designed to offer comfort and a cozy atmosphere perfect for family gatherings or intimate dinners.
One of the standout features of Haven Sampoorna is its attentive customer service. Reviews from satisfied diners highlight the swift service, with meals typically arriving within 10 to 15 minutes. Patrons are greeted by friendly staff fluent in Hindi, English, and Tamil, enhancing the welcoming vibe that makes every visit special.
For those who enjoy a range of flavors, dishes like the Haven cheese & corn fritters and Malai broccoli have received high praise. The menu caters to all palates with an excellent selection of vegetarian options, ensuring there's something for everyone. Whether you're in the mood for a comforting tomato basil soup or a fragrant and hearty biryani, you'll leave with your taste buds satisfied and your heart full.
Don’t forget to make a note: due to its popularity, reservations through platforms like Dineout are recommended, especially on weekends when the restaurant tends to buzz with excited diners. Additionally, the availability of an elevator makes it accessible for all, though parking could be an area to keep in mind.

“ Good multi cuisine vegetarian restaurant in Velachery. While food taste was good, cost is definitely on the higher side. Update: Haven Sampoorna's vegetarian menu keeps growing compared to what was there few years earlier. Being Sunday evening, some wait time was there due to the crowd. Service was good and as mentioned earlier cost is high. Overall good food. Aug'22 Update:. Visited again and tried few items on their ever growing menu. I tried to compare with the few items which I tried it in another veg restaurant recently and unfortunately Haven Sampoorna fell short on the taste. As mentioned earlier, cost is too high even with the similar restaurant type. Dec'23 Update: More varieties added to the menu. No prior reservations and on first come first serve basis. Expect to wait for 30 to 45 mins during peak hours. Jul'25 update: Revisited this place after a year and half later. Fully crowded and so much noise inside the restaurant. Food was good but aloo mutter was very bland. ”

“ After some Google map search for Fine dine Veg restaurant came here. Worth it definitely. Good Ambience. Awesome Customer care n service esp by Sajan. He spoke in Tamil and made us so comfortable. Ordered Monchow soup- right amount of spices and hot soup. Corn n Cheese fritters were too good. Ratatouille n Herbed rice was so tasty esp the Herbed rice was too good. Tandoori sizzler was good esp Pulao, Paneer. Dal Makhani was kind of bland and very less spicy. Sizzling hot Brownie with Icecream was as usual good. Better go for their mexican and other continental cuisine than usual Indian ones. Keep up the good work esp customer service the best ”
